Location9161 Industrial Ct, Gaithersburg, MD 20877, USAPosition SummaryProduction role in consumables, kit or reagent manufacturing responsible for meeting production schedules in a fast‑paced, high‑throughput industrial setting. This may include the production of coated plates, chemical buffers, and biological diluents/reagents and/or assembled kits for customer order fulfillment. Some degree of professional latitude, creativity and self‑management is expected.Duties and ResponsibilitiesOperate automated equipment used to perform and produce biological assays and/or reagentsContribute to process improvement, assay and process development for manufacturingDocumentationComplete appropriate documentation to support process and production procedures including data capture, forms, logbooks, and inventory batch recordsDaily maintenance and documentation of all production equipmentParticipation in general laboratory maintenance including maintaining laboratory cleanliness, supplies and equipmentMaintain physical inventory by processing/aliquotting/vialing/labeling materials.Prepare, maintain and report raw material, reagent and/or coated plate inventories.Participate in year‑end physical inventoryFollow laboratory safety precautions and use of personal protective equipmentMay manufacture custom and/or prototype requests for customersMay occasionally handle BSL2 reagentsSpecific duties may vary depending upon departmental requirementsExperience and QualificationsHigh School diploma requiredA degree in Biology, Chemistry, Biotechnology, Engineering or related field is preferredPrior manufacturing experience a plusExperience with MRP/ERP and JDE systems preferredExperience with cGMP and/or ISO certification highly preferredKnowledge, Skills and AbilitiesAptitude for learning and adhering to standard laboratory techniques and safety precautionsUnderstand scientific fundamentals and analytical backgroundAbility to learn additional software applications/toolsMechanical aptitude including equipment troubleshootingExcellent oral, written communication and interpersonal skillsEffectively communicate issues/problems and results that impact timelines, accuracy and reliability of dataProficiency in MS Office SuiteAbility to multi‑task and work productively in a demanding manufacturing environment with changing prioritiesPhysical DemandsThis position requires the ability to communicate and exchange information, utilize equipment necessary to perform the job, and frequent lifting up to 50 lbs.Up to 80% of the day may be spent at a lab bench and/or in the cleanroomWork EnvironmentStandard industrial manufacturing, logistics and/or cleanroom environmentCompensation SummaryThe annual base salary for this position ranges from $39,600 to $57,500.
